KTimeableInterruptEvent: Difference between revisions

No edit summary
No edit summary
 
(2 intermediate revisions by 2 users not shown)
Line 4: Line 4:
Size : 0x10 bytes
Size : 0x10 bytes


Abstract class used as base for [[KThread]], [[KTimer]], etc.
Abstract class used as base for [[KThread]], [[KTimer]], and the dummy subclass of the attribute at offset 0x10 of [[KTimerAndWDTManager]].
Instances of these classes are kept track of by the [[KTimerAndWDTManager]].
Instances of these classes are kept track of by the [[KTimerAndWDTManager]].
 
As of [[11.3.0-36]], a second virtual method was added to decide whether to remove an object from the list of objects tracked by the [[KTimerAndWDTManager]] instance, see changelog.
 
{| class="wikitable" border="1"
{| class="wikitable" border="1"
|-
|-
Line 24: Line 26:
| 0x8
| 0x8
| s64
| s64
| Desired time point (relative to the CPU power-on) in CPU ticks for [[KTimerAndWDTManager]] when it's handling its list of [[KTimableInterruptEvent]] instances
| Desired time point (relative to the CPU power-on) in CPU ticks for [[KTimerAndWDTManager]] when it's handling its list of [[KTimeableInterruptEvent]] instances
|}
|}